Liam suffered a brain injury called encephalitis when he was 6 (a month before turning 7). The damage to his brain took away his speech, personality, changed his behavior. He had to learn to walk, run, and eat again. He has developmental regression and needs constant care and help with day to day things. He started a school for kids with disabilities this year and has learned how to feed himself and other things. He has some sensory issues around his head and face, and will have his first 24-48 hour EEG in 1.5 years very soon. I think this will help him forget they are on and help him relax and leave them alone!
